Test of the zoom function on the Sony SR45. I believe that the zoom function does not amplify the object the camera is focused on but rather just more sensitive, or amplified in general.

  • Would you reccomend this type of microphone for filming steam engines coming towards you, and you want to pick up as much sound from them as possible?

  • Smerlinare, No I wouldn't. The zoom microphone function is not that at all, it is just increases the amplification when you zoom. Which would help in your situation but probably not capture what you are looking for. Is what your looking for professional grade or just home owner? The reason I ask is because if you want to capture good sound, buy a camcorder that has a built in external microphone such as a shotgun mic.
